Evacuation-chair store — quick notes for team assistants.

Location: stairwell landing, level 3, Pellbrook Wing, marked cabinet beside the fire hose. Two chairs inside; both checked monthly by Facilities, log card on the inner door. Do not borrow for furniture moves — ever. If a chair is deployed, report it the same day so Hartquist Safety can re-inspect. New assistants must complete the ten-minute handling demo before their first floor-warden shift. The cabinet stays locked outside drills and emergencies. Open it with the code below.

turnstile pass: bdg-YPPQB-52010

Handover — Vexler partner SFTP drop

Ownership moves to you today. Drop runs hourly from Vexler's end into the intake bucket via the relay host. Watch for zero-byte files; their exporter flakes on Mondays. Creds live in the ops vault, path noted in the runbook. Vault auto-seals after 48h idle. Support escalations go to the on-call rotation, not me. If the vault is sealed when you need it, unseal with the recovery passphrase below.

recovery phrase for tadug-fafof: zorwyn-kasion

[ ] Step 4 — Meritstack loyalty ledger key rotation. Verify both custodians are present and the Ardenvale signing module is offline. Generate the new ledger key, record the fingerprint in the ceremony log, and confirm escrow upload. To validate the escrow copy, decrypt the test bundle with the recovery passphrase below.

vault phrase of kajop-bahof = fenys-pelix-quenax-sildor-lammir-pelix-pelox-belwyn-zorok

- [ ] Verify log compaction on the Quellbrook message queue before sealing the ceremony. Plugin authors should confirm their topics use compacted retention so replayed keys resolve to the latest value only. Run the compaction sweep, check the cleaner lag is zero, and record the segment count in the ceremony log. Once verified, unlock the escrow shard using the passphrase below.

unlock words, fafop-hawep: briwyn-oliix-sorox

**Runbook: tailing logs with `logpeek`**

Quick refresher for the sync: `logpeek tail --service checkout-core` streams the last 500 lines, and `--follow` keeps it live. If output looks stale, bounce the relay with `logpeek relay restart` (takes ~10s, don't panic). Filters stack, so `--level warn --since 15m` works fine together.

If you file a ticket about weird output, include the build trace from your session, shown below.

session token of fahap-hawip = htk31_7852f2b3276dba2738f98fa97f92237